The video walks you through APIC web interface in Cisco ACI 6.0. APIC GUI is one of many, although probably most common, ways to configure and operate Cisco ACI fabric. It is important for you to become familiar with the web interface. We will help you navigate around key APIC menu options in preparation for actual configuration in the future labs.

Part 1 of this video covers System menu
